Contracting Specialist NF3 RFT

QUANTICO MCCS
Quantico, VA Other
POSTED ON 4/22/2026
AVAILABLE BEFORE 4/28/2026
Marine Corps Community Services (MCCS) is looking for the best and brightest to join our Team! MCCS is a comprehensive program that supports and enhances the quality of life for Marines, their families, and others in the Marine Corps Community. We offer a team oriented environment comprised of military personnel, civilian employees, contractors and volunteers who keep the organization functioning smoothly and effectively.

Qualifications:

BACHELOR¿S DEGREE from an accredited college or university in contracting or acquisition planning or a related field appropriate to work of the position, OR an appropriate combination of education and experience that demonstrates possession of knowledge and skill equivalent to that gained in the above, OR THREE YEARS of practical experience that demonstrates that the applicant has acquired the knowledge, skills, and abilities equivalent to that gained in the above. 

Must demonstrate knowledge of the organizations, program objectives, technical requirements of assigned commodities or services, business practices and sources of supply.  Knowledge of a limited range of contract types, required clauses, and special provisions to carry out procurement actions.  Knowledge of the procurement process, the activity's procurement needs, market sources, and related business practices, operations, and structures to identify contractual opportunities for small and disadvantaged businesses.  Knowledge of procurement statutes, Executive Orders, policies and regulations.  Must have the ability to successfully complete required training.   

This position is designated as a Position of Trust, and the incumbent must be eligible for a background check.  Appointment and continued employment is subject to a favorable National Agency Check with Inquiries (NACI) background check. Must file an annual Confidential Financial Disclosure report (OGE form 450).

Responsibilities:

  • Serves as Contract Specialist for the Regional Procurement Office (RPO) and is responsible for pre-award and post award functions for a variety of services, equipment, materials and supplies. Carefully reviews the proposed request and recommends proper format and procedure for compliance with rules, regulations, and policies established by higher authority. Responsible for subject matter negotiation, preparation, completion and accuracy of the contracting and procurement process, up to the finalization of a signed contract/agreement. 

  • May meet and discuss with division director or representative to ensure that all material specifications, conditions and/or provisions desired are included in the resulting legal document. Maintain contract file, their amendments and operational records to include contract performance records, insurance certificates, wage and hour determinations issued by the Department of Labor, etc.  Consults with the supervisor to set the overall objectives and resources available and develop deadlines for projects and work to be done.   

  • Independently plans and carries out assignments to include determining the approach to be taken or methodology to be used, developing a fact-finding plan and determining the depth of analysis required.

  • Coordinates matters with technical specialists, legal specialists and other contract personnel. Ensures PII compliance in the handling of personal data regarding contactors.

  • Provide World Class Customer Service with an emphasis on courtesy. Assists customers and communicates positively in a friendly manner. Take action to solve problems quickly. Alerts the higher-level supervisor, or proper point of contact for help when problems arise.  Adhere to safety regulations and standards.  Promptly reports any observed workplace hazards, and any injury, occupational illness, and/or property damage resulting from workplace mishaps to the immediate supervisor.  Adhere to established standards of actively supporting the principles of the EEO program and prevention of sexual harassment. 

  • Performs other related duties as assigned. This is a white-collar position where occasional lifting up to 20 lbs may be required.

Salary : $55,000
